How users examine and rank visual information

Users follow predictable patterns when examining digital screens. Eye-tracking experiments demonstrate that users scan pages in F-shaped or Z-shaped motions. The top-left corner receives attention first in most many. Viewers spend more time on larger elements and heavy typeface. Vibrant hues and strong contrast zones capture instant attention.

The brain interprets visual content in milliseconds. People form rapid assessments about screen quality before reading copy. Titles and visuals receive priority over body text. The importance of size, contrast, and placement in structure

Scale defines immediate significance in visual presentation. Bigger components overshadow smaller ones and attract attention first. Headlines utilize bigger typefaces than body copy to communicate priority. Designers resize visuals and buttons according to their operational importance.

Contrast distinguishes components and defines associations between elements. Deep copy on light backdrops provides legibility and attention. Color contrast highlights calls-to-action and important content. High contrast pulls attention while weak contrast recedes into backgrounds.

The effect of color and spacing on perception

Hue shapes feeling response and content organization. Hot colors like red and orange create immediacy and enthusiasm. Cool colors such as blue and green convey serenity and reliability. Designers apply colors based on brand character and practical function. Stable hue coding enables users spot patterns swiftly.

Spacing governs visual compactness and information grouping. Close separation joins related components into integrated sections. Broad separation divides distinct areas and prevents confusion. Sufficient borders improve readability and decrease eye stress.

Nearness concepts establish perceived connections between objects. Components positioned close together look related in role or meaning. Balanced arrangement of space creates cohesive compositions that steer attention organically.

How attention moves across distinct interface elements

Navigation options get immediate attention during screen interactions. Users scan navigation choices to comprehend site layout and offered alternatives. Core menu generally anchors at the upper or left area. Distinct titles help users locate target areas rapidly.

Hero visuals and banners dominate initial browsing instances. Large visuals express brand image and core content instantly. Compelling imagery maintains attention longer than content blocks. Successful hero areas equilibrate visual appeal with educational value.

Call-to-action buttons attract focus through hue and placement. Differing button hues isolate behaviors from nearby material. Scale and form separate interactive elements from unchanging copy. How evaluation assists optimize attention movement

User evaluation shows how actual users interact with visual hierarchies. Eye-tracking experiments reveal specific gaze sequences and focus spots. Heat visualizations show which zones capture the most focus. Click analysis identifies where users expect interactive components. These discoveries reveal differences between interface expectations and observed behavior.

A/B experimentation evaluates various structure approaches to measure success. Designers evaluate alternatives in scale, hue, and location concurrently. Engagement percentages reveal which arrangements steer users toward intended actions. Analytics-driven decisions displace personal opinions and suppositions.

Usability research uncovers ambiguity and navigation difficulties. Testers express their thinking processes while completing activities.
